I recently agreed to take part in a cycling adventure to ride from San Francisco to Los Angeles.  

Unsure whether I would be able to complete this challenge I was reluctant to inform anyone before I had completed the journey - possibly one of the hardest things I have ever done! Having completed the challenge on the 4th September, I feel I can share the moments.  

As you can imagine going up the hills was hard, especially in the heat of the Californian summer, but coming down was far easier, sometimes at speeds of 40mph (64kmph!).
